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,322,676,562
Lastest Block:
1,958,794
Utxos:
1,983,703
Nodes:
331
OmniXEP Contracts:
274
Block details
[STAKE]
28/11/2025 22:06:40 UTC
Txid
b2c2a96e3105d865ca1a2431f83ba4cee0d08e0900b0a06b0e9e27f53c109c88
Block
1,942,020
Block hash
a722e028f3aca30235e83820919d73925445fcfe700b643d44b644d2501fd6fc
Stake amount
115.66079731 XEP
Sender
ep1qfyj00296fvpkee5qgdc0u0xl355l9ctdm6n895
Recipient
ep1qm532mm6yrs7z2cyw0rcslya09vnqa7htw8me46
(2,250,474.56026418 XEP)